Summary Consolidated Financial Data
Non-GAAP Measures, page 14

2.       We note your Non-GAAP Net Loss and Non-GAAP gross profit metrics
include an
         adjustment for your warranty provision. It is unclear to us why you
believe adjusting for
         your warranty provision is appropriate, given that warranty matters
are a normal recurring
         cost associated with the production of goods and warranty matters are
ultimately cash
         settled. Please explain to us why you believe the adjustment is
appropriate or otherwise
         remove the adjustment from your non-GAAP measures. Refer to Item
10(e)(1)(ii) of
         Regulation S-K and also Question 100.01 of the Commission's Compliance
and
         Disclosure Interpretations for Non-GAAP Financial Measures for
guidance.
Risk Factors
Some of our end customer and other third-party agreements provide ..., page 21

3.       We note your disclosure that you hold various third-party development,
product
         collaboration, and tech licensing agreements with third parties.
Please disclose the scope
         and term of any material agreements and file them as exhibits to your
registration
         statement. In addition, include a discussion of the duration and scope
of the agreements
         that are material to your business.
Industry and Market Data, page 55

4.       Please tell us whether you commissioned any of the reports or studies
referenced in this
         section. With respect to the disclaimer regarding the disclosure
characterized as "Gartner
         content," please explain the basis for attempting to limit investors'
reliance on the
         information provided. In doing so, please indicate how management
assessed the
         reliability of the information and whether it has adopted this
information as management's
         belief.
Management's Discussion and Analysis of Financial Condition and Results of
Operations
Results of Operations
Comparison of Year Ended December 31, 2021 and 2020, page 69

5.       Please expand you MD&A to quantify the individual factors that
contributed to the overall
         decrease or increase in your financial statement line items. For
instance, quantify the
         impact increased wafer fabrication costs and reduced yields on newer
products had on
         your overall decrease in gross margin.
Employees; Facilities, page 92

6.       We note your disclosure that you have employees located in the US,
China, Taiwan and
         Singapore, along with offices in Austin, Taiwan, and China. Please
clarify specifically
         where you have facilities and a distribution of your employees by
location.
